Quick Answer

క్యాబేజీ is Cabbage in English

Also known as पत्ता गोभी (Patta Gobhi) (Hindi), முட்டைக்கோஸ் (Muttaikose) (Tamil), ಎಲೆಕೋಸು (Elekosu) (Kannada)

vegetableAvailable year-round

Cabbage

Cabbage is a versatile vegetable used in stir-fries, curries, and salads. It's popular in Telugu cuisine with preparations like cabbage pesarapappu and cabbage curry.

Key Facts About Cabbage

  • క్యాబేజీ is the Telugu name for Cabbage
  • Category: Vegetable
  • Best season: Available year-round, best in winter
  • Common in: Telugu, South Indian, and Indian cuisine
  • Calories: 25 kcal per 100g

Health Benefits of Cabbage

  • Low in calories, great for weight loss
  • Rich in Vitamin C and K
  • Contains anti-inflammatory compounds
  • Good for gut health

How to Cook Cabbage

  1. 1Shred finely for quick cooking
  2. 2Don't overcook to retain crunch
  3. 3Great with senagapappu (chana dal)
  4. 4Add curry leaves and mustard for flavor
